Maxx Crosby: Performance and Challenges in the 2025 Season

Crosby recently finished a turbulent season despite maintaining elite production. The five-time Pro Bowl defensive standout continued to anchor the Raiders’ defense at a high level, but a lingering knee injury forced him to miss the final stretch of the season. According to sources, Crosby’s frustration over being shut down early strained his relationship with the organization, fueling speculation that Las Vegas could listen to trade offers if the return is substantial.
Crosby has also openly criticized reports about the Raiders shutting down players, calling them “a lot of bulls–t”, signaling his determination to play at a high level and contribute fully to a team’s success. This attitude has attracted attention from several NFL teams, including the New England Patriots, who are evaluating the possibility of acquiring him.
Tactical Benefits of Adding Crosby to the Patriots
For New England, discussions about Crosby go beyond simple interest. A source familiar with Patriots’ thinking stated that the question is not whether Crosby fits — his impact on the field is obvious — but whether the timing aligns with the team’s broader roster plan. The Patriots are currently in a transitional phase, balancing salary cap flexibility, the development of a young core, and the desire to accelerate their return to contention. Any move involving a premium asset like Crosby must fit this long-term vision.
From a football perspective, adding Crosby would immediately transform the Patriots’ defense. His ability to generate pressure without relying heavily on blitzes would reduce the burden on the secondary and elevate the performance of the entire front seven. This makes him a highly attractive target for a team looking to build a flexible, high-impact defense.
